NVIDIA Invests $5B in Intel

According to Reuters, U.S. chip giant NVIDIA has completed a major equity investment in Intel, purchasing USD 5 billion worth of Intel shares under an agreement reached in September this year. Intel confirmed the transaction in a regulatory filing released on Monday (29), formally acknowledging that NVIDIA has finalized the investment.

The filing shows that NVIDIA acquired 214,776,632 Intel shares through a private placement at USD 23.28 per share, bringing the total investment to USD 5 billion. Following the deal, NVIDIA now holds around 4% of Intel's outstanding shares, making it one of Intel's key shareholders. The terms of the transaction are fully in line with the investment agreement announced earlier this year.

Industry observers see the move as a significant financial boost for Intel, which has faced mounting pressure in recent years due to strategic missteps and heavy capital spending tied to large-scale manufacturing expansion. The investment is widely viewed as strengthening Intel's balance sheet at a critical time for its turnaround efforts.

Intel also stated that U.S. antitrust regulators have approved NVIDIA's investment. Earlier this month, the U.S. Federal Trade Commission (FTC) confirmed it had completed its review of the transaction without objection.

In market trading, NVIDIA shares dipped about 1.3% in pre-market activity, while Intel's stock showed little immediate reaction.
